What’s the purpose of AM radio?

AM broadcasting is radio broadcasting using amplitude modulation (AM) transmissions. It was the first method developed for making audio radio transmissions, and is still used worldwide, primarily for medium wave (also known as “AM band”) transmissions, but also on the longwave and shortwave radio bands.

Which is more power efficient AM or FM?

In FM systems, the power of the transmitted signal is proportional to the amplitude of the unmodulated carrier signal and it is constant. Therefore, FM is usually more power-efficient than AM systems. In FM systems, the frequency deviation of the signal is related to the noise ratio.

What are the advantages and disadvantages of FM radio?

A distinct advantage that FM has over AM is that FM radio has better sound quality than AM radio. The disadvantage of FM signal is that it is more local and cannot be transmitted over long distance.
